Susan Leigh Smith (ne Vaughan; born September 26, 1971) is an American woman who was convicted of murdering her two sons, three-year-old Michael and 14-month-old Alexander, in 1994 by drowning them in a South Carolina lake. As the diver's testimony took the jury under the lake and inside the car, people in the courtroom gasped, some bowed their heads, and Mrs. Smith, charged with murder for drowning her sons by allowing her car to roll down a boat ramp and into the lake, chewed her nails and sobbed without making a sound.
